VIDEO: The 33rd annual Knuckleheads Garage Car Show took place at Fonner Park at the Heartland Events Center. The fundraising event was raising money for the Thin Line Project, which benefits fallen and injured first responders. Officials said supporting the local community is important, and our first responders are valuable to the community. “They’re the ones that provide us protection,” said organizer Danny Oberg. “You know they’re the ones that provide us with safety and you know a lot of times you know these people put their lives in danger for other people and I can’t imagine that life and you just gotta appreciate it.” Oberg said they feature classic cars because they are nostalgic and people love to see craftsmanship.
